By December 2019, Resource Group will have trained in excessof 700 aviation maintenance apprentices – significantly contributing togovernment targets of achieving 3 million apprenticeships by 2020 andaddressing the well-documented critical skills shortage in the aviation sector.

On 17 September 2019, Resource Group will host its annual Apprentice Awards Ceremony which will take place at Cotswold Airport, Gloucestershire. The ceremony will celebrate the hard work and dedication of all students who have completed the full time, highly intensive, 8-month theoretical and practical element of the EASA Part-66 Category A programme.



The ceremony will be the biggest event to date, with 77apprentices graduating and over 200 individuals confirmed as attending.Attendees include the students, together with their families and employers.

All apprentices will receive their graduation certificatesand four special awards will be presented on the day, including the AcademicApprentice Aircraft Award, Exemplar Apprentice Aircraft Award, Hand Skills -Aircraft Award, Chairman’s Award (new for 2019).

Resource Group looks forward to continuing to serve thesector by training more of the UKs future engineers and raising the awarenessof the fantastic and fulfilling opportunities on offer for young people in theaviation industry.

Resource Group’s CEO, Stephan Hickman comments: ‘‘As part ofour group strategy we will continue to invest in and grow our trainingbusinesses. The industry we serve demands high standards, not minimumstandards. The training philosophy that the Resource Group has built, whichplaces significant emphasis on practical training in an appropriateenvironment, will remain a cornerstone of our group’s expansion plans both inthe UK and beyond.”
